Structure Factors And Their Distributions In Driven Two-Species Models, G. Korniss, Beate Schmittmann Oct 1997

Structure Factors And Their Distributions In Driven Two-Species Models, G. Korniss, Beate Schmittmann

Beate Schmittmann

We study spatial correlations and structure factors in a three-state stochastic lattice gas, consisting of holes and two oppositely “charged” species of particles, subject to an “electric” field at zero total charge. The dynamics consists of two nearest-neighbor exchange processes, occurring on different times scales, namely, particle-hole and particle-particle exchanges. Using both Langevin equations and Monte Carlo simulations, we study the steady-state structure factors and correlation functions in the disordered phase, where density profiles are homogeneous. In contrast to equilibrium systems, the average structure factors here show a discontinuity singularity at the origin. The associated spatial correlation functions exhibit intricate …
